Stay near popular Nuuk attractions

Nuuk Harbour

8.8/10 (10 reviews)
Greenland's largest port bustles with fishing vessels and cruise ships against a backdrop of fjords and mountains. Summer visits offer the richest maritime activity and most spectacular Arctic waterfront views.

National Greenland Museum and Archives

9.4/10 (3 reviews)
Discover 4,500 years of Greenland's history through artefacts and the famous Qilakitsoq mummies. The museum's colonial-era buildings near the old harbour create an authentic backdrop for exploring Inuit heritage.

Vor Frelsers Kirke

7.2/10 (5 reviews)
Nuuk Cathedral's striking red wooden exterior has stood as a Lutheran landmark in Greenland's capital since 1849. Explore its serene interior before strolling through the historic Colonial Harbour district nearby.

Hans Egede Statue

7.8/10 (7 reviews)
Perched on a hill overlooking Nuuk's Colonial Harbour, this statue honours missionary Hans Egede who founded the city in 1728. The surrounding Old Nuuk area offers insights into Greenland's colonial past.

"The staff and apartments were outstanding. Especially Kristine stood out with her kindness and willingness to help. The only reason I rated the apartments as 4 and not 5 stars, is that they actually are shared which is not obvious from the booking website. Each unit seems to have 4 bedrooms (2 doubles and 2 singles), and you share the rest of the apartment with other guests. The indicator on the website was the "sleeps 8" comment, that I found surprising but did not investigate further. I was under the impression that I was renting a one-bedroom apartment with kitchen, bathroom and living area. Uur unit companions were equally surprised to see other residents, so it was not only us who missed that aspect. At 60+, I'm not exactly keen on sharing a bathroom with strangers. We were lucky and had great and respectful room mates, but I could easily see this as being a source of contention. So it's more like a very nice hostel than a rental apartment. Also, the manager walked into our unit twice with her key, without even knocking - unacceptable behavior."

"Pleasant enough and reasonably well located, with walking distance from Nuuk's center of activity as 5 to 15 minutes, Nuuk's historic old town as about 10 to 15 minutes, and the port at around 25 minutes walking. Rooms are small but have the essentials. The blackout shades during the summer midnight-sun months are only partially effective as they allow light in at the edges. The place is mostly quiet as long as the guests are courteous, as they usually are. Note that the place may not have hot water for showering during daytime hours after check-out time at 10 am and before check-in time at 4 pm. Note also for anyone with walking challenges that there is a bit of a short, steep rock incline and over a dozen stairs just to enter the place."

Best time to go to Nuuk

The best time to visit Nuuk can depend on the weather and when visitor numbers rise and fall. The hottest average temperature in Nuuk falls in July, when vis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ly sunny with light rain. The coolest average temperature in Nuuk falls in February,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ly cloudy with no rain.

calendar iconCalendar Monthtemperature iconTemperaturerain iconPrecipitationmostly cloudy iconCloudinessoccupation rate iconOccupancyprice iconPricing
January12.9°F (-10.6°C)No RainMostly CloudySlightly HighAverage
February10.4°F (-12.0°C)No R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low
March13.6°F (-10.2°C)No RainMostly CloudySlightly LowAverage
April24.6°F (-4.1°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
May33.1°F (0.6°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ly LowAverage
June41.7°F (5.4°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ly High
July47.3°F (8.5°C)Light RainMostly SunnyAverageAverage
August46.6°F (8.1°C)Light RainMostly SunnySlightly HighSlightly High
September39.6°F (4.2°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ly HighSlightly High
October30.4°F (-0.9°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ly LowAverage
November19.9°F (-6.7°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low
December16.0°F (-8.9°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low

The nearest major airports for your trip to Nuuk

Visiting Nuuk, Sermersooq, is convenient when flying into Nuuk Airport (GOH), located 3.2km from the city. Nearby accommodation options include Inuk Hostels, a budget-friendly option, and the 4-star Hotel Hans Egede, along with HOTEL SØMA Nuuk, all situated within the same distance from the airport. Transportation services are available from these hotels to the airport, typically for a fee. Alternatively, you may consider flying into Maniitsoq Airport (JSU), which is situated 148.1km away from Nuuk, though this may require additional travel arrangements.

What's the seasonal weather in Nuuk?
The hottest months are usually July and August, with an average temperature of 7°C, while the coldest months are February and January, with an average of -10°C. Average annual precipitation for Nuuk is 782 mm.
